An editorial in The Hindu Business Line examines the high-stakes gamble of a leadership change in Karnataka, emphasizing the accompanying political risks. The analysis suggests that such a move could impact state governance and economic policy continuity, potentially affecting business sentiment in the region.

High stakes gamble," discusses the potential for a leadership change in Karnataka and highlights the significant political risks involved. The piece notes that any shift in the state's leadership would be far from straightforward, carrying implications for the stability of the ruling coalition. The editorial does not name specific individuals or parties but underscores the delicate balance required to navigate such a transition. It suggests that the decision is a calculated risk with uncertain outcomes, influenced by internal party dynamics and the broader political landscape. The analysis points to historical precedents where leadership changes have led to both consolidation and fragmentation, cautioning that the current environment may amplify these risks. The editorial emphasizes that the move is not merely an administrative adjustment but a high-stakes political maneuver that could reshape the state’s governance trajectory.

Key takeaways from the editorial include the notion that political stability in Karnataka is closely watched by businesses and investors. A leadership change, if it occurs, could create short-term uncertainty regarding policy directions, particularly in sectors like infrastructure, technology, and agriculture where state-level decisions matter. The editorial implies that such transitions might delay approvals or shift priorities, potentially dampening the investment climate. Additionally, the risk of coalition friction could lead to frequent disruptions, affecting the predictability of the business environment. The piece also suggests that market participants would likely monitor the process for signs of continuity or change in fiscal policies and regulatory approaches. The absence of specific data in the editorial means these takeaways are drawn from general economic principles, yet they highlight the broader sensitivity of regional markets to political developments.

From an investment perspective, a leadership change in Karnataka could influence sectors with high exposure to state policies, such as renewable energy, information technology, and real estate. While the editorial does not provide concrete projections, historical patterns suggest that political transitions often lead to a reassessment of risk premiums for state-linked bonds and equities. Investors may adopt a cautious stance, awaiting clarity on the new leadership’s economic agenda. The broader implication is that political stability remains a key factor for state-level growth, and any perceived weakness could temper capital inflows. The editorial’s framing underscores the need for stakeholders to stay informed about the evolving political scenario, as it may have downstream effects on market sentiment. Ultimately, the outcome of such a decision would likely rely on how smoothly the transition is managed and whether it fosters governance continuity.
